<h3 style="text-align:left;">Declines in Major Cryptocurrencies</h3>
<p style="text-align:left;">The value of leading cryptocurrencies took a significant hit on Monday. Bitcoin was recorded at approximately $85,894.03, marking a 6% decline from its previous trading values. Ether followed suit, experiencing an 8.4% decrease, reaching $2,776.39. Notably, Solana fell more than 9%, trading below $125, contributing to a broader sell-off in the cryptocurrency market, which saw many tokens fall into the red. These notable declines raise concerns about the health of the cryptocurrency ecosystem, especially given the high volatility that typically characterizes this domain.</p>
<p style="text-align:left;">This downturn comes after a notable sell-off that began in October, exacerbating fears of further losses. Analysts highlight that retail investors, who react differently compared to institutional players, seem to be at the helm of the current wave of sell-offs. Their decisions are often influenced by market sentiment, which can swing dramatically in a matter of hours.</p>
<h3 style="text-align:left;">Repercussions in Asia</h3>
<p style="text-align:left;">The turmoil in cryptocurrency markets has had ripple effects in Asia, particularly in Hong Kong. A recent statement from the People&#8217;s Bank of China issued on Saturday raised alarms regarding illegal activities associated with digital currencies. This warning exerted additional pressure on shares of companies linked to digital assets, which saw a significant decline during Monday&#8217;s trading session.</p>
<p style="text-align:left;">Investors expressed growing concern about regulatory crackdowns in the region, further complicating an already tense sentiment in the market. This stance from the Chinese authorities seems to have amplified the anxiety among traders, furthering the exodus from riskier assets like cryptocurrencies. As a result, companies with significant exposure to digital assets have seen their stock prices tumble, elevating fears about the overall market stability.</p>
<h3 style="text-align:left;">Factors Contributing to the Sell-Off</h3>
<p style="text-align:left;">Several indicators contributed to Monday&#8217;s cryptocurrency sell-off. Experts point towards a hefty $400 million in liquidations that occurred across multiple exchanges as a significant factor. <strong>Ben Emons</strong>, founder and CIO of Fedwatch Advisors, elaborated on the factors at play by noting, </p>
<blockquote style="text-align:left;"><p>&#8220;There is still a lot of leverage in bitcoin out there. We can expect to see more of these liquidations if bitcoin prices don&#8217;t get off the lows from here.&#8221;</p></blockquote>
<p> This statement underscores the substantial leveraged positions being held by cryptocurrency traders, some reaching as high as 200x in certain exchanges.</p>
<p style="text-align:left;">With an estimated $787 billion in outstanding leverage in perpetual crypto futures, the recent downturn can be attributed to a precarious balancing act that many traders are engaging in. If Bitcoin fails to rebound, the liquidations are likely to continue, driven by the automated positions that close when they reach certain profit or loss thresholds. This creates a cycle of selling that compounds the initial dip, demonstrating the fragility of the market in volatile conditions.</p>

<h3 style="text-align:left;">Historical Context: 77 Years of Conflict</h3>
<p style="text-align:left;">The date of the march held particular significance, as it marked the 77th anniversary of the UN&#8217;s adoption of the Partition Plan for Palestine. This plan facilitated the gradual withdrawal of British troops and the proposed establishment of both Palestinian and Israeli states. However, this historical context is intertwined with the tragic events that followed, which Palestinians refer to as the Nakba — a period in which around 750,000 people were displaced from their homes and many lives were lost.</p>
<p style="text-align:left;">This history frames the continuing struggle for Palestinian statehood and rights, highlighting the longstanding grievances and trauma experienced by the Palestinian people. The anniversary served as a reminder of the unresolved issues that continue to fuel tensions in the region, and it accentuated the urgency for activists and organizations working for peace and justice.</p>

<h3 style="text-align:left;">Overview of the Protest</h3>
<p style="text-align:left;">On Saturday, November 15, 2025, Mexico City witnessed a significant anti-government protest that turned violent, particularly in the historic Zocalo Square. This protest was primarily organized by younger citizens, specifically those belonging to Generation Z, who feel disenfranchised and unsafe in their own country. Amidst rising crime rates and widespread corruption, these young individuals took to the streets to voice their discontent against the current administration and the situation in Mexico, reflecting a deep-seated frustration that has been brewing in society for years.</p>
<h3 style="text-align:left;">Details of Violence and Police Response</h3>
<p style="text-align:left;">As the protest escalated, chaotic scenes unfolded in the streets, marked by clashes between demonstrators and police. Authorities reported that at least 60 police officers sustained minor injuries during the confrontation. Some officers were subjected to physical attacks, while others experienced explosive devices being thrown in their direction. The Secretariat of Citizen Security reported that 40 officers required medical attention, with four needing specialized care due to trauma from the conflict. Amidst this turbulence, officials emphasized that police did not engage in violent repression but instead focused on containment, a decision that appears to have been made in light of the escalating tensions and past experiences with civil unrest.</p>
<h3 style="text-align:left;">Voices from the Demonstrators</h3>
<p style="text-align:left;">Participants in the protest articulated their grievances clearly, highlighting concerns about corruption and the urgent call for enhanced public safety measures. Among them was <strong>Arizbeth Garcia</strong>, a physician who expressed her disillusionment with the current security situation, stating that “doctors are also exposed to the insecurity gripping the country, where you can be murdered and nothing happens.” Another demonstrator, <strong>Rosa Maria Avila</strong>, aged 65, shared her feelings of loss and anger stemming from the recent assassination of anti-crime mayor <strong>Carlos Manzo</strong>, which represented a significant blow to community efforts against organized crime. &#8220;The state is dying,&#8221; Avila lamented, emphasizing the necessity for a more aggressive stand against criminal elements that threaten public safety.</p>
<h3 style="text-align:left;">Government&#8217;s Reaction and Outlook</h3>
<p style="text-align:left;">In light of the protests and the underlying dissatisfaction, President <strong>Claudia Sheinbaum</strong> has faced mounting criticism regarding her administration&#8217;s handling of security issues. Appointed as Mexico’s first female president in October 2024, she is accused of failing to adequately address the spiraling violence fueled by drug cartels. Critics assert that her government&#8217;s inaction and tolerance for organized crime only exacerbate public unrest. Following the assassination of <strong>Carlos Manzo</strong>, who had previously criticized the president for her lack of decisive action against criminal activities, the calls for reform within her administration have intensified. Sheinbaum has remained steadfast in her stance, previously rejecting military assistance from external forces to combat the problem, thus asserting Mexico&#8217;s sovereignty in dealing with its issues.</p>

<h3 style="text-align:left;">Legislative Background</h3>
<p style="text-align:left;">The ban is rooted in a series of legislative actions taken by Hungary&#8217;s Parliament earlier this year. In March, lawmakers passed a measure that grants the government authority to disallow public events organized by LGBTQ+ groups, followed by a constitutional amendment specifically targeting such gatherings. Critics, including legal experts and human rights advocates, argue that these legislative measures serve as tools for authoritarian governance, marking a significant regression in Hungary’s commitment to democratic principles and human rights.</p>
<h3 style="text-align:left;">Police Justifications for the Ban</h3>
<p style="text-align:left;">The Budapest Police articulated their justification for the ban, stating concerns about potential illegal activities that could involve minors. They argued that &#8220;it cannot be ruled out, or is even inevitable, that a person under the age of 18 will be able to engage in legally prohibited conduct&#8221; should they attend the march. The authorities further expressed fears about the potential for &#8220;passive victims,&#8221; suggesting that minors could inadvertently become involved in activities they did not wish to partake in, given the public nature of the planned assembly.</p>

<h3 style="text-align:left;">Background Information on the Suspect</h3>
<p style="text-align:left;">Mohamed Sabry Soliman, age 45, is an Egyptian national who is currently in the United States with a visa that is set to expire in March 2025. His immigration status has come under scrutiny given the violent actions he proposed to carry out. During interviews with federal authorities, it was revealed that Soliman had spent a significant year preparing for the attack, underlining a deeply-held resentment that ultimately manifested in his intent to harm. His motivations, beliefs, and actions have led to his classification as a domestic threat, raising questions about how security protocols could be improved to prevent similar incidents.</p>
<h3 style="text-align:left;">Details of the Attack</h3>
<p style="text-align:left;">The planned attack occurred on June 1 at about 2 p.m. MST, targeted at a peaceful gathering known as &#8220;Run For Their Lives,&#8221; which aimed to raise awareness about Israeli hostages. According to the complaint, Soliman arrived at the Pearl Street gathering early and became immersed in the event&#8217;s atmosphere. Upon launching two lit Molotov cocktails into the crowd, he yelled phrases such as &#8220;Free Palestine!&#8221; This aggressive action resulted in injuries to twelve individuals, with one person reported in critical condition. Fortunately, there have been no fatalities. Witnesses and law enforcement described the event as chaotic, highlighting both the urgency of the situation and the immediate response needed to manage such threats.</p>
<h3 style="text-align:left;">Motivation Behind the Attack</h3>
<p style="text-align:left;">Soliman’s motivations are documented extensively in a federal complaint, where he reportedly expressed disdain towards what he termed a &#8220;Zionist group.&#8221; In his statements, he conveyed a belief that the participants represented an existential threat to Palestine. Soliman chillingly declared, “I would do it again,” signifying an alarming commitment to his extremist views. This type of rhetoric raises essential discussions about the radicalization process and ideologies that lead individuals to commit acts of political violence. His remarks also shed light on the potential risks posed by individuals who may be immersed in perilous beliefs and ideologies.</p>
<h3 style="text-align:left;">Law Enforcement Response</h3>
<p style="text-align:left;">Following the incident, law enforcement quickly apprehended Soliman on-site. Initial investigations revealed an array of evidence, including 14 additional unlit Molotov cocktails and a collection of incendiary materials in his vehicle. Authorities discovered notes with words like &#8220;Israeli,&#8221; &#8220;Palestine,&#8221; and &#8220;USAID,&#8221; hinting at the depth of his grievances. Video footage captured the chaotic moments following the attack, illustrating the immediate threat that Soliman posed to the attendees. The swift response from law enforcement played a crucial role in mitigating further injuries or potential loss of life.</p>

<h3 style="text-align:left;">Overview of March Housing Market Trends</h3>
<p style="text-align:left;">The housing market&#8217;s performance in March was markedly disappointing with a reported 5.9% decline in the sales of previously owned homes from February, leading to an annualized sale rate of 4.02 million units, according to data from the NAR. This number signifies the slowest pace for March in over a decade, touching on the severity of the ongoing housing downturn. Compared to the same period last year, sales were down by 2.4%, indicating consistent weakness across the market. The overall sentiment among potential homebuyers has shifted due to high mortgage rates, which reached over 7% earlier in the year, leading to affordability concerns that have hampered transactions.</p>
<h3 style="text-align:left;">Regional Breakdown of Home Sales</h3>
<p style="text-align:left;">Sales figures varied significantly across different regions of the United States. The most pronounced decline occurred in the West, which saw a downturn of more than 9% month over month. This is noteworthy as the West had previously been the only region to experience a year-over-year gain, particularly due to robust job growth in the Rocky Mountain states. In contrast, other regions were not spared from the downturn as sales also dropped month on month. This disparity suggests localized economic factors influencing the housing market&#8217;s trajectory, with some areas benefiting from stronger economic conditions while others struggle with declining buyer interest.</p>
<h3 style="text-align:left;">Inventory Levels and Their Impact on Pricing</h3>
<p style="text-align:left;">Interestingly, despite the drop in home sales, the market has seen a notable increase in inventory levels. As of March, 1.33 million homes were listed for sale, marking an increase of nearly 20% from the previous year. This surge in listings is critical for prospective buyers, potentially offering more choices but also leading to a cooling in price appreciation. The median home price for existing homes sold during March stood at $403,700, which, while still an all-time high for that month, represented a modest increase of just 2.7% compared to March 2024. This trend hints at a shifting dynamic in the market where an increase in available inventory, coupled with sluggish sales, might begin to exert downward pressure on prices over time. The typical definition of a balanced market is a 6-month supply of inventory, while currently, the market operates with a 4-month supply, suggesting it remains lean despite the increase in listings.</p>
<h3 style="text-align:left;">Buyer Demographics and Market Participation</h3>
<p style="text-align:left;">The demographic landscape of the home-buying market remained relatively stable, with first-time buyers comprising 32% of the market in March, unchanged from the previous year. Historically, this figure hovers around 40%, indicating a potential reluctance among new buyers due to the current economic climate and the challenges presented by high mortgage rates. Additionally, the percentage of all-cash sales experienced a slight decline, falling to 26%, while institutional investors constituted about 15% of total sales. This demographic stability amid declining purchases reflects the diverse strategies of buyers navigating the current market environment while grappling with affordability issues and a tightening credit landscape for potential homeowners.</p>
